
Ezekiel 10
This chapter details the departure of the glory of the Lord from the Temple. The glory of God, which rests above the cherubim, moves to the threshold of the Temple. Fire is taken from between the cherubim and scattered over the city. The glory of God then moves to the east gate of the Lord’s house. The appearance of the cherubim and the wheels is described in detail, confirming they are the same creatures seen in the first chapter's vision, symbolizing God's mobility and sovereignty.
